comparemela.com
Home
Solutions Amp Tech
Top Locations Tagged with Solutions Amp Tech
Solutions Amp Tech in United States - 37917/Security-systems near Knox
1). Security Solutions & Tech Inc, Knoxville
Solutions Amp Tech in United States - 77032/Water-treatment near Houston
2). Veolia Water Solutions & Tech, World Houston Pkwy
Solutions Amp Tech in United States - 12308/Waste-reduction near Schenectady
3). Veolia Water Solutions & Tech, Erie Blvd
Solutions Amp Tech in United States - 21046/Professional-engineers near Columbia
4). Sensible Solutions & Tech Inc, Stevens Forest Rd
Solutions Amp Tech in India - 682001/Contract-manufacturing near Ernakulam
5). Spiral Solutions & Tech, Vapor Trl
vimarsana © 2020. All Rights Reserved.